Too Many Race Tracks are Closing

from Automotive ADHD · host Matt West

I talk about the latest automotive internet trend, how Yamaha is building engine parts from wood in an effort to be "environmentally sustainable", and how a decline in race tracks is leading to a perceived increase in street racing and takeovers.
